Bong brought Everett Wilcox from Four Creeks UAC Four Creeks have 15 board members, 2 each from electoral districts and 5 at large members, not all active. Board members serve 2 year terms, 1/2 up for election each year. Consensus is hard to reach with 15 members, 12 is a more workable number. Four Creeks has no central business district and is served by 3 school districts, it is composed of 11 housing developments and an amount of underdeveloped area. Four Creeks is South of Bellevue, East of Renton, West of Tiger Mt. Problems studied by Four Creeks include the Cedar Hills Landfill, Cedar Grove composting Operation, Roads, compliance of County Standards, Communication towers and transportation. Resources: Brian Derdowski is their King County Council Rep and helps them with mailing lists, mailings, etc. Bong helps with printing. They receive many notices of action in their area from the county and are encouraged to respond with comments. They receive good results from the executive side of the KCC, the entire council is more dicey. Everett served on the Citizens Participation Initiative process. A council needs 6 hard workers that are willing to put in 2 hours of meeting a month and at least that again in homework or research.
